Taking into account these various factors, we can write a semiempirical mass equation. 5). Such an equation, first derived by C. F. 8) The first term in this equation takes into account the proportionality of the energy to the total number o f nucleons (the volume energy); the second term, the variations in neutron and proton ratios (the asymmetry energy); the third term, the Coulomb forces of repulsion for protons (the Coulomb energy); the fourth, the surface tension effect (the surface energy).
